Default Skype.. Is It Worth It

Does anyone have skype?

How good is the service etc?

As I will be traveling alot with my new job I was wondering if it would be any good downloading skype.

I will want to dial mobiles and landlines in Dublin and Corkso if you have any info on how good it is etc I would greatly appreciate it.

Voipbuster is probably better, all landline calls to Ireland are free.

www.voipbuster.com
or

http://www.voipcheap.co.uk
(they are the same company but have some better rates for some reason) Both need a topup of 10euro or something, but you can try them out for free with a 1 minute lasting calls to the free destinations.

Quality is decent enough using a good headset or phone adapter.
